Roxanne.

One word, one name, evokes a visceral reaction from all who know of the woman who has been a lightening rod for controversy, progress, justice and hilarity.

In this podcast, a conversation between a few old friends, listeners can get a sense of why this is, and what drives one of the most iconic leaders in the state of Iowa, and beyond.
